The Business Administration program prepares students for transfer into the junior year at four-year colleges or universities. It also prepares them for many entry-level positions. This program includes required courses in accounting, business administration, business law, economics, and other business-related courses, as well as general education and free electives. The courses in the Business Administration degree program are sequenced to conform to the freshman and sophomore year course patterns at four-year colleges and universities. However, students planning to transfer to the Rutgers School of Business or other AACSB Schools are encouraged to consider enrollment in the Business Liberal Arts program.

The University has articulation agreements with many New Jersey community colleges to facilitate transfer from those institutions to William Paterson. These agreements address transfer admissions for students earning associate's degrees from state community colleges, policies governing acceptance of general education credits, and admission to specific academic programs.

While the official William Paterson University Transfer Credit Policy is to accept a maximum of 60 credits from a New Jersey community college, William Paterson University will accept ALL ASSOCIATE'S DEGREE CREDITS under the program-to-program transfer articulation agreements listed below. To ensure transfer of ALL ASSOCIATE'S DEGREE CREDITS in an eligible community college major, students must have an official community college transcript declaring an associate's degree in that major AND apply for the articulated William Paterson University bachelor's degree.

Per the Lampitt Law (www.njtransfer.org) when students transfer into WPU with an A.A. or A.S. from a New Jersey Community College (on or after January 1, 2005) all of WPU's lower level core classes (University Core Curriculum [UCC]) will be waived. William Paterson University will also waive all credits earned at a New Jersey community college for an Associate of Fine Arts (A.F.A).

William Paterson University is currently working on updating the articulation agreements below. Once each agreement is signed off by both the community college and William Paterson University, the link next to the program will be activated to show the course equivalencies accepted by William Paterson University for the major.

With an emphasis on affordability and high-quality instruction, Warren County Community College ranks among the best community colleges in New Jersey. In addition to the option to study at one of two convenient campus locations, students may also pursue a variety of certificates and degrees entirely online, making WCCC an ideal choice for working professionals and students with family responsibilities.

The college features programs of study in areas like business management, early childhood education, computer and information sciences, and aerial drone technology. Students who want to hone a particular skill can also enroll in online career training classes that cover subjects such as accounting, grant writing, and working with special needs students.

In addition to on-campus programs, Raritan Valley Community College offers three degrees and certificates completely online, including an associate of applied science in accounting. Another 14 degree programs at the college -- including a program business administration and health information technology -- are available 85% online. Distance learners enjoy the same services as in-person students, including tutoring and career counseling.

Formed in 2019 by the merger of two community colleges, Rowan College of South Jersey now offers more than 120 degrees and certificates online and at two campuses. Distance education programs at the college feature five-, seven-, and 15-week classes, giving online learners even more flexibility to choose a pace of learning that best suits their needs. Any student who graduates from RCSJ with a GPA of 2.0 or higher receives guaranteed admission to Rowan University, a four-year institution in Glassboro, New Jersey.

RCSJ also provides a host of scholarships to make the community college experience even more affordable. For example, the Presidential Start Smart Scholarship provides $1,000 to first-year students who graduated in the top 15% of their high school class.

Unlike many other community colleges, Sussex County Community College gives students the option to earn a bachelor's degree in business, nursing, or education without needing to relocate. Students on this track first earn an associate degree then take a series of transitional courses. They can then enroll in upper-level coursework offered by Felician University on the Sussex campus.

Sussex also hosts fully online degree programs in business administration, English, and liberal arts. As coursework in these online programs are available in an asynchronous format, students can watch lectures, contribute to class discussions, and complete assignments entirely on their own schedule.

In addition to operating three campuses in the Jersey City area, Hudson County Community College offers fully online associate programs in accounting, business administration, criminal justice, health sciences, and history. The school delivers dozens of additional courses online, allowing students in on-campus programs to enjoy the convenience of distance education along with the individual attention of the traditional classroom experience.
